A.One-way ANOVAs (Analysis of Variance)
The results of all parameter from three set (A, B and C)
were analyzed by statistically method with One-Way ANOVA
followed with Duncan’s multiple comparison tests. ANOVA
is a technique used to compare means of three sample set of
waste water treatment. The ANOVA tests the null
hypothesis that samples in three groups are strained from
samples with the same mean values. P values less than 0.05
were considered statistically significant.

Arithmetic mean average is the sum of a collection of
sample quality values divided by the number of numbers in
the collection.
C. Standard deviation (SD)
Standard deviation is a measure that is used to quantify the
amount of variation or dispersion of a set of data values.
